Two Transported to Hospital Following Linda Vista Hazmat Incident

Two people were injured in a hazardous material incident Thursday in Linda Vista, the San Diego Fire-Rescue Department said.

A man and a woman were transported as trauma patients to Sharp Memorial Hospital after the San Diego Police Department responded to a call about a car with "something" inside, officials said.

The call came in around 1:15 p.m. at the intersection of Tait Street and Linda Vista Road, San Diego police Officer Billy Hernandez said. 

When officers arrived, they found two people unconscious in the car that came to a stop at the street corner, partially blocking traffic lanes.

The San Diego County Hazardous Materials Division was called in to evaluate the car the two people were in, SDFD spokeswoman Monica Munoz said.

It was unclear what was in the vehicle.

No other information was available.
